10.3 Noem DRIE voordele van 'n bout met meervoudige skroefdrade.

Die drie voordele van 'n bout met meervoudige skroefdrade is:
Verhoogde Klem: Meervoudige skroefdrade bied 'n groter klem en stabiliteit in vergelyking met enkelvoudige skroefdrade.
Versnelde Installasie: Meervoudige skroefdrade neem minder tyd om te draai, wat instandhouding en installasie vinniger maak.
Verminderde Slipping: Dit verminder die kans op slipping terwyl die bout aangelê word, wat lei tot 'n veiliger en meer betroubare verbinding.
